Passmark

This is the most ubiquitous GPU benchmark. It gives the graphics card a thorough evaluation under various types of load, providing four separate benchmarks for Direct3D versions 9, 10, 11 and 12 (the last being done in 4K resolution if possible), and few more tests engaging DirectCompute capabilities.

Pros & cons summary


Performance score 57.77 42.46
Recency 25 August 2023 17 October 2023
Chip lithography 5 nm 7 nm
Power consumption (TDP) 245 Watt 250 Watt

RX 7700 XT has a 36.1% higher aggregate performance score, a 40% more advanced lithography process, and 2% lower power consumption.

RX 6750 GRE, on the other hand, has an age advantage of 1 month.

The Radeon RX 7700 XT is our recommended choice as it beats the Radeon RX 6750 GRE in performance tests.
